switch語句正確格式
2023-05-08 17:25:31 閱讀(562)
unity內(nèi)switch函數(shù)的用法?
用法如下: switch語句格式: { case常量表達(dá)式1:語句1; case常量表達(dá)式2:語句2; … case常量表達(dá)式n:語句n; default :語句n+1; }
c語言case格式?
switch語句的格式如下:switch (expression) {case常量表達(dá)式1:語句1 case常量表達(dá)式2:語句2 case常量表達(dá)式:語句3 case常量表達(dá)式n:語句n。從語句函數(shù)的角度來看,用PASCAL和case語句或FOXBASE do case語句中的常量表達(dá)式與case后面的表達(dá)式進(jìn)行比較,確定執(zhí)行哪條語句。一旦某條語句被執(zhí)行,它將自動結(jié)束該語句。而c的switch語句不是。首先,switch語句中的常量表達(dá)式只是作為一個入口點(diǎn)。
解釋switch語句的結(jié)構(gòu)要素?
switch語句的格式: switch (表達(dá)式){ case目標(biāo)值1: 執(zhí)行語句1 break; case目標(biāo)值2: 執(zhí)行語句2 break; ...... case目標(biāo)值n: 執(zhí)行語句n break; default: 執(zhí)行語句n+1 break; } 在上面的格式中,switch語句將表達(dá)式的值與每個case中的目標(biāo)值進(jìn)行匹配,如果找到了匹配的值,會執(zhí)行對應(yīng)case后的語句,如果沒找到任何匹配的值,就會執(zhí)行default后的語句。
c語言怎么使用switch語句?
方法/步驟 第一首先創(chuàng)建一個c語言項目。 然后在導(dǎo)入需要的頭文件。 第二然后寫入頭文件stdio.h。 再寫入mian主函數(shù)。 第三然后定義一個int類型的i變量。 再輸出該該變量的值。 第四然后接受i變量的數(shù)值。 代碼為scanf("%d",&i)。 第五然后寫入多幾個除mian主函數(shù)以外的函數(shù)。 在這些函數(shù)中,輸出內(nèi)容。 第六然后利用switch語句接受i變量。 再進(jìn)行判斷和跳轉(zhuǎn)到其他函數(shù)中,執(zhí)行函數(shù)的內(nèi)容。 這樣switch語句的功能可以體現(xiàn)出來了。 在c語言中switch語句主要就是用于判斷和跳轉(zhuǎn)頁面的語句,所以今天就來為大家介紹c語言怎么使用switch語句。
switch語句基本形式?
switch(week){ case “1”: printf("周一"); break; case “2”: printf("周二"); break; 。。。。。。。 default: printf("周二"); break; } int i;switch (i){ case 1: printf("周一"); break; case 2: printf("周二"); break; default: printf("周二"); break;}
switch后面要加end嗎?
不需要。switch語句格式: switch(表達(dá)式) { case常量表達(dá)式1:語句1; case常量表達(dá)式2:語句2; … case常量表達(dá)式n:語句n; default:語句n+1; }
51單片機(jī)switch語句用法?
switch主要用來判斷變量不同值情況下,執(zhí)行不同的操作。 先計算并獲得switch后面小括號里的表達(dá)式或變量值,然后將計算結(jié)果順序與每個case后的常量比較,當(dāng)二者相等時,執(zhí)行這個case塊中的代碼,當(dāng)遇到break時,就跳出switch選擇結(jié)構(gòu),執(zhí)行switch選擇結(jié)構(gòu)之后的代碼。如果任何一個case之后的常量與switch后的小括號中的值不相等,則執(zhí)行switch尾部。 的default塊中代碼。
switch語句用法?
switch語句用于多分支選擇,使用switch可以更快捷地完成條件判斷。 格式如下: switch(expression){ case value1: 執(zhí)行代碼; break; case value2: 執(zhí)行代碼; break; ... default: 執(zhí)行代碼; } expression: 一個表達(dá)式,其值與case語句的值進(jìn)行比較,如果相等,則執(zhí)行相應(yīng)的代碼。 value1, value2: 與expression進(jìn)行比較的值。 default: 匹配項不存在時,默認(rèn)執(zhí)行的代碼塊。
switch語句用法?
用法:在C語言中,switch語句是開關(guān)語句,一般與case、break、default配合使用,對流程進(jìn)行控制。 switch作為一個開關(guān),當(dāng)變量表達(dá)式的值對應(yīng)case中的值時,執(zhí)行case后面的語句后跳出switch語句,如果都不符合則執(zhí)行default后面的語句后跳出switch語句。
switch語句用法?
1、switch語句可以根據(jù)條件的不同執(zhí)行不同的代碼塊。 2、這是因為switch語句可以比多個if-else語句更加簡潔和易于閱讀,尤其是當(dāng)需要測試的條件有多種可能時,用switch語句可以更清晰地組織代碼。 3、除了常規(guī)使用,switch語句還可以用于枚舉類型或者字符串類型的判斷,這為程序的編寫提供了更多的靈活性和可擴(kuò)展性。
未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明出處